People Around the Globe Are Filling Cracks With LEGO (10 Photos)

For the last decade, Berlin-based artist Jan Vormann has been patching crumbling facades with LEGO. The artist has been filling cracks, gaps and holes with the ubiquitous blocks and has inspired and encouraged other to do the same around the globe.

In an evolution of the project, Vormann has launched Dispatchwork which tracks, documents and catalogues people around the world using LEGO to ‘reclaim their share of the public space’.
